## Changed Defaults — Pointsgrove Ledger v3.2

Heads-up for review: we've flipped the ledger's default accrual mode from batched to streaming, since the batch path kept piling up during the Harvest Days promo and support got flooded with "where are my points" tickets. Expiry defaults also tightened from 24 to 18 months to match the revised program terms. Nothing changes for tenants with explicit overrides; only fresh installs pick up the new behavior. For reference, the new default configuration shipped with this release is:

deployment values, yadug-bawif:
[framir]
team = pelox
access_code = ac_a38ab2
owner = tamion.julael
host = framir.tolvaqlabs.test
port = 11211
peer = tammir.zemvargrid.local
salt = 2215ef03
pin = 1541

# TrailMark Field Survey — offline mode config
# Offline mode caches survey forms and GPS fixes locally on the device,
# then syncs once connectivity returns. Release managers: enable this
# flag only for builds shipped to the Kestrel Valley pilot crews, since
# the sync queue has not been load-tested beyond 40 devices. Cache TTL
# defaults to 72 hours; do not shorten it for this release. The sync
# endpoint requires signed requests. The signing credential goes on the next line.

sealed setting: COURIER_KEY29=170ad45524657711572101e080d15

Alert: ORDERS_SOFT_DELETE_SPIKE

This fires when the rate of soft deletes in the Brindlewood orders table exceeds 3x the trailing seven-day baseline over a 15-minute window. Soft deletes set the retired_at column; rows remain queryable by downstream reconciliation jobs, so a spike usually means a bulk cleanup script or a misbehaving cancellation flow in the Quillhaven checkout service, not data loss. Check recent batch jobs first, then cancellation error rates. Runbook steps and past incident notes are on the page below.

operations page: https://confluence.tolvaqsys.corp/spaces/pages/pages/6e787158f507

Subject: Tidebell widget cut-over — done!

Hi folks, the Tidebell tide-table widget is now fully on the new prediction backend as of this afternoon. Old endpoints stay up read-only for a week, then we tear them down. If you're on call and see stale tide data, the usual fix is restarting the sync worker — takes about two minutes. The worker now runs with the following settings.

settings of tagef-bawif:
DRUIX_HOST=druix.zemvarlabs.internal
DRUIX_PORT=8000